Optical modules are compatible with a variety of indoor and outdoor ODF cabinets, including floor-standing, wall-mounted, and street cabinets designed for fiber termination, patching, and cross-connect applications.Indoor CabinetsOptical Distribution Frame (ODF) cabinets are commonly used indoors for high-density fiber management. Examples include Belden's DCX ODF Cabinets, which can hold multiple ODF housings and are configurable with doors, side panels, and cable management accessories for secure and organized fiber connections . Samm Teknoloji's FDF Series cabinets also provide modular shelves for connector panels, splicing, and patching, supporting 19" or ETSI installations and allowing flexible placement of optical modules . These cabinets are ideal for exchanges, head ends, or customer premises environments, offering easy access for installation and maintenance.Outdoor CabinetsFor outdoor applications, street or pad-mounted cabinets provide environmental protection and secure housing for optical modules. Corning's OptiTect® Gen III Series Local Convergence Cabinets manage up to 432 fibers and accommodate feeder, distribution fibers, and splitter modules in a single enclosure suitable for aerial or buried cables . Similarly, Samm Teknoloji's FDF-ODC-2-X and Idea Optical's outdoor distribution cabinets are IP65-rated, watertight, and designed for fiber cross-connection in FTTH networks, supporting modular optical equipment while protecting against dust, moisture, and mechanical stress .Module Compatibility and StandardsOptical modules installed in these cabinets typically include splitter modules, patch panels, and splice trays. Most cabinets are designed to be compatible with standard 19" fiber optic modules and comply with industry standards such as Telcordia GR-1209-CORE and GR-1221-CORE . Cabinets often feature horizontal and vertical patchcord management, slack storage, and flexible mounting options to accommodate different module sizes and configurations.Key ConsiderationsCapacity: Choose cabinets based on the number of fibers, modules, and commutation fields required .Environment: Indoor cabinets are suitable for controlled environments, while outdoor cabinets must be weatherproof and secure .Accessibility: Front and side access, swing handles, and removable panels facilitate installation and maintenance .Flexibility: Modular designs allow future expansion and integration with other optical network components .In summary, optical modules can be installed in a wide range of indoor ODF cabinets, floor-standing racks, and outdoor street or pad-mounted cabinets, with compatibility determined by module size, cabinet design, and environmental requirements. Proper selection ensures efficient fiber management, protection, and scalability for both FTTx and enterprise networks.
